Typically, a board fence consists of three to four rows of 1x6 boards stretched between pressure-treated posts spaced eight to 10 feet apart. Even though a board fence is made of rot-resistant wood like pressure-treated pine, cedar, or redwood, most property owners paint it to prolong its lifespan.

Feb 11, 2013 · A barbed wire fence is the least expensive, but is also high-maintenance and has a shorter lifespan. To hold cattle in, Parish says a fence should generally be about five-feet tall. "From the bottom of the ground, 11-18-inches is probably the good range on where you need to be above the ground. That's a start right there," says Parish.

Training cattle to respect electric fencing pays off during the winter months, Chrisp says. “Winter facilities can be built or changed easily, at low cost, with electric fence, compared with having to build permanent pens or fences.” Chrisp winters 65 young bulls that are approaching sale age on 80 acres. Feb 15, 2020 · 2. The Grounding Rods. This should be sunk completely underground and be installed within 20 feet of the area where the fence energizer is located. Once you’ve done this, you need to run the grounding wire from the rod to the fence charger and ensure that it’s secured tightly. If you get one that won't respect it, they need to go somewhere else, if you plan to use ...We evaluated the application of virtual fencing for grazing dairy cows, to gain an understanding of how individuals learn virtual fence simuli. The virtual fence contained cattle within predetermined areas for most of the time (99%).
